St. Lachlan Hotel and Suites

St. Lachlan Hotel and Suites Address: St. Anthony's Lane, Ethukala, Negombo, Sri Lanka

Minimum price found for St. Lachlan Hotel and Suites was: 12200 LKR

Click here to get more information, photos & guest ratings for St. Lachlan Hotel and Suites